Michael P. Sheerin

TLC Engineering for Architecture Inc.’s board of directors announced that Michael P. Sheerin, PE, LEED AP BD+C, has been named to succeed Debra Lupton as CEO of the firm. Sheerin is currently serving as the firm’s director of health care engineering. He will assume the role of CEO in early 2015. Sheerin graduated from The City College of New York with a Bachelor of Engineering in mechanical engineering and had design and contracting experience in New York City and Washington, D.C., before joining TLC in 1995. In addition to overseeing TLC’s health care practice firm-wide and his involvement on national health care standards, such as ASHRAE standard 170 health care ventilation, Sheerin has held key roles in the design of many award-winning projects, including the Fort Benning Martin Army Community Hospital in Fort Benning, Ga., and Nemours Children’s Hospital in Orlando, Fla.
